logo

Output 403f156b67526e25ca1d536eb8e74ea968944a01d0090a67830b4150cf3f80a8:1

value
592499013
script pubkey
OP_0 OP_PUSHBYTES_20 a62318ac8be9f26ca4d4268470807b51e670d4f6
address
bc1q5c333tyta8exefx5y6z8pqrm28n8p48kc2rd8f
transaction
403f156b67526e25ca1d536eb8e74ea968944a01d0090a67830b4150cf3f80a8